Msgr Patrick Eluke Ordained As the Auxiliary Bishop Of Port Harcourt Diocese.

Hitory was made today the 9th of May 2019 as the Catholic Diocese of Port Harcourt got its first indigenous Bishop since the creation of the diocese fifty eight years ago.Very Rev Monsignor Patrick Eluke who was chosen by the Pope as the Auxiliary bishop of Port Harcourt to assist Bishop A. Etokudoh in the pastoral care of the diocese was born on 25th March 1967 in Ekpeye, Ahoada, Rivers State, in the diocese of Port Harcourt.After his primary school education, he entered the Sacred Heart Minor Seminary and continued with courses in philosophy at the Bigard Memorial Seminary, Ikot-Ekpene, and had his Theology studies at the Bigard Memorial Major Seminary, Enugu.He was ordained a Catholic priest on 23rd September 1995, and incardinated into the diocese of Port Harcourt.Rev. Fr. Patrick also obtained a civil doctorate degree in biblical studies at the University of Port Harcourt.Since priestly ordination, he has held the following offices:
parish vicar of Saint Anthony’s parish, Igwuruta (1995-1996);
pastor of Saint Bernard’s parish, Biara (1996-1997);
pastor of Saint Dominic’s parish, Bane, and Saint Francis’ parish, Kpean (1997-2002); pastor of Saint Paul’s parish, Ngo (1997-2005);
pastor of the Saints Peter and Paul parish, Elenlenwo (2005-2007);
pastor of the Queen of the Apostles parish, Rumuepirikom (2007-2012);
pastor of the Sacred Heart parish, Mile II Diobu (2012-2013);
chaplain of the Annunciation Chaplaincy, University of Port Harcourt (2013-2015); lecturer in Biblical Studies, University of Port Harcourt (since 2014);
